Brand Overview

In my experience reviewing mattresses, both Avocado and Saatva offer distinct features that cater to various sleeping needs. Here’s a closer look at each brand.

Avocado

Avocado specializes in organic and eco-friendly mattresses. They offer:

  • Products: Organic latex mattresses, innerspring mattresses, pillows, and bedding accessories.
  • Materials: Certified organic latex, organic cotton covers, and natural wool. Avocado mattresses are free from harmful chemicals.
  • Pricing: Mattresses range from $1,299 to $2,399, depending on size and model.
  • Certifications: G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ard), Greenguard Gold, and MADE SAFE.
  • Warranty: 25-year warranty covering manufacturing defects and material issues.
  • Unique Features: Their Green Certified mattress combines organic latex with pocketed coils for enhanced support and durability.

Saatva

Saatva focuses on luxury and comfort with a range of high-quality mattresses. They provide:

  • Products: Innerspring, memory foam, and hybrid mattresses, along with pillows and bed frames.
  • Materials: Eco-friendly foams, individually wrapped coils, organic cotton covers, and copper-infused fabrics for temperature regulation.
  • Pricing: Mattresses start at $799 and go up to $2,499, depending on size and construction.
  • Certifications: GOLS (Global Organic Latex Standard), ISO certifications, and OEKO-TEX.
  • Warranty: Lifetime warranty covering defects in materials and workmanship.
  • Unique Features: Their Saatva Classic model offers dual-coil systems and adjustable firmness levels to accommodate different sleep preferences.

Pricing and Value

Understanding the pricing and value of Avocado and Saatva helps in making the right choice. Here’s what I discovered:

Cost Comparison

Avocado’s mattresses range from $1,299 to $2,399, reflecting their commitment to organic materials and sustainability. Saatva offers a broader price spectrum, starting at $799 and going up to $2,499, catering to various budgets with innerspring, memory foam, and hybrid options. For example, I noticed an Avocado Green Mattress costs around $1,799, while Saatva’s Classic Innerspring Mattress starts at approximately $799. This range allows customers to find a mattress that fits both their financial plans and desired features.

Warranty and Trial Period

Avocado provides a 25-year warranty, highlighting the durability of their organic components. They also offer a 1-year trial period, letting customers test comfort in their homes. Saatva stands out with a lifetime warranty, underscoring their confidence in long-lasting quality. Additionally, Saatva includes a 180-night trial period, giving ample time for evaluation. These warranties and trial periods enhance each brand’s value, catering to different preferences and ensuring satisfaction.
